We are seeking an Employee Experience and Engagement Leader to join our team at Bell. In this role, you will be responsible for developing and implementing programs that enhance the overall employee experience and engagement.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in human resources, with experience in program management and process improvement. They will also poss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ills, as well as the ability to analyze data and develop insights.

This position requires a high level of autonomy and independence, as well as the ability to work collaboratively with stakeholders across the organization. The successful candidate will have a strong understanding of workplace culture and the importance of creating a positive work environment.

Bell is committed to providing its employees with a comprehensive compensation package, including medical, dental, vision, and mental health benefits. We also offer a 35% discount on our services and access to exclusive offers from our partners.

In this role, you will have the opportunity to contribute to the development of innovative solutions that support the well-being of our employees.
